Evidence supporting the use of: Goldthread
For the health condition: Burns and Scalds
Synopsis
Source of validity: Traditional
Rating (out of 5): 2
Goldthread (Coptis chinensis), known as Huang Lian in Traditional Chinese Medicine (TCM), has a long history of use in East Asian herbal medicine for various ailments, including burns and scalds. Its traditional application is primarily due to its "heat-clearing" and "detoxifying" properties, as described in classical TCM texts. Topical preparations or poultices made from Goldthread or its extracts have been used historically to reduce inflammation, prevent infection, and promote healing in minor burns and skin lesions. The primary active compound, berberine, has demonstrated antimicrobial and anti-inflammatory actions in laboratory studies, but these studies are not specifically focused on burn or scald wound healing in humans. There is a lack of robust clinical trials or systematic reviews validating Goldthread’s efficacy for burns or scalds by modern medical standards. Therefore, while its use is well-established in traditional practice, the scientific evidence supporting its effectiveness for this specific condition is limited, and its traditional rating is moderate rather than high.
